WILBERFORCE, WILLIAM.
Adm. pens. (age 18) at TRINITY, June 26, 1817. [Eldest] s. of William (above) (and Barbara Ann, dau. of Isaac Spooner). B. [July 21, 1798], at Clapham, Surrey . School, in Cambridgeshire . Matric. Michs. 1817.
Adm. at the Middle Temple, Oct. 9, 1820.
Called to the Bar, Nov. 25, 1825.
J.P. for Yorkshire . and Middlesex . Elected M.P. for Hull, 1837, but the return was amended by order of the House, 1838.
Married, June 19, 1820, Mary Frances, dau. of the Rev. John Owen (1784), R. of Paglesham, Essex , and had issue.
Joined the Church of Rome, 1850.
Died May 26, 1879.
Brother of Robert I. (1826) and Samuel (1860).
( Boase, III. 1343; Law Lists; Inns of Court; Return of M.P.s. )
